Job Description

A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) is sought for a contract position in a school setting in Esparto, CA, serving PreK and Kindergarten students. This full-time role offers 37.5 hours per week during the school year from August 20, 2026, to June 4, 2027. The caseload includes approximately 25-35 young students requiring speech and language services.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ct speech and language assessments and develop individualized treatment plans.
  • Deliver therapy services to PreK and Kindergarten students to improve communication skills.
  • Collaborate with educators and families to support student progress.
  • Maintain thorough documentation and comply with state and school regulations.

Qualifications:

  • Current Speech-Language Pathologist license (SLP).
  • Certification of Clinical Competence (CCC) preferred.
  • Experience working in school settings is highly desirable.
  • Candidates licensed in other states will be considered if willing to obtain California licensure.
  • Strong communication and organizational skills.

Location:

  • Onsite work at a school in Esparto, California.
